The Adult Education Ministry of the church provides the
foundational strategy for evangelism, discipleship,
fellowship, ministry and worship. It enables us to reach
people with the Gospel of Jesus Christ, to teach and
study the Scripture of God's Holy Word and to minister
to the needs of those around us. At the core of every
individual is the need for relationships. We desire a
relationship with God, our Creator, and with fellow
Christians with whom we share a common bond. By
gathering together in small groups, studying and
discussing God's Word, sharing the issues and
challenges of life, and praying and caring for one
another, we experience the abundant life Christ came
to give. We also grow in our knowledge and
understanding of the Bible, connect with others in
similar life stages, build lasting friendships, and discover opportunities to engage in ministry action.

DiscipleLife - Classes Offered in the Fall and Spring
Matthew 28:19-20 states, "Therefore go and make disciples..." We are a church that takes this verse very seriously. Not only do we desire to see individuals come into a saving relationship with Christ, we encourage everyone to steadily grow in their relationship with Christ. That is why we offer these opportunities of discipleship. Regularly attending a worship service or Sunday School class does not make one a disciple. A disciple is one who individually and continually seeks to grow in their faith and relationship with Christ through study of God's Word and other helps, and responds to the direction or change that God produces in their life. Each fall and winter/spring we offer a variety of classes that will hopefully encourage you in your relationship as a follower of Christ. It is our desire that you will take advantage of these excellent opportunities of discipleship.
